Cappadocia Weather by Month: Complete Climate Guide

Last updated: March 2026

Quick Answer

Cappadocia has a continental climate with hot dry summers (30-35°C in July-August) and cold snowy winters (-5 to 5°C in January-February). Sp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) offer the most pleasant temperatures at 15-25°C.

Detailed Guide

Cappadocia sits at an elevation of about 1,000 meters in Central Anatolia, giving it a semi-arid continental climate with four distinct seasons. Summers are hot and dry with temperatures often exceeding 30°C, while winters bring snow that beautifully covers the fairy chimneys. The region receives most of its rainfall in spring, with very dry conditions from June through September. Temperature swings between day and night can be significant — even in summer, evenings can be cool. The best months for visiting are April-May and September-October when temperatures are comfortable and tourist crowds are moderate. Winter visits (December-February) offer magical snow-covered landscapes and fewer tourists, but some outdoor activities may be limited.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best month to visit Cappadocia?

April-May and September-October offer the best balance of pleasant weather (15-25°C), fewer crowds, and reliable hot air balloon flights. June is also excellent with longer days.

Does it snow in Cappadocia?

Yes! Cappadocia gets snow from December through February, sometimes into March. Snow-covered fairy chimneys are breathtaking. Average snowfall is moderate but enough to transform the landscape.

How hot does Cappadocia get in summer?

July and August temperatures regularly reach 30-35°C. The heat is dry, making it more bearable than humid climates. Evenings cool down to around 18-22°C. Hydration and sun protection are essential.

Is Cappadocia windy?

Cappadocia can be windy, especially in spring. Wind affects hot air balloon flights — flights are canceled when winds exceed safe limits. The region is generally less windy than coastal Turkey.

Cappadocia Weather in January: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

January in Cappadocia averages -4°C–4°C with 40 mm of rainfall and possible snow. Crowd levels are very low, hot air balloon flights operate at 30–50% (weather dependent), and hotel prices are lowest.

Cappadocia Weather in February: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

February in Cappadocia averages -3°C–6°C with 35 mm of rainfall and possible snow. Crowd levels are very low, hot air balloon flights operate at 40–60%, and hotel prices are lowest.

Cappadocia Weather in March: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

March in Cappadocia averages 1°C–11°C with 38 mm of rainfall. Crowd levels are low, hot air balloon flights operate at 55–70%, and hotel prices are low.

Cappadocia Weather in April: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

April in Cappadocia averages 5°C–17°C with 45 mm of rainfall. Crowd levels are moderate, hot air balloon flights operate at 80–90%, and hotel prices are moderate.

Cappadocia Weather in May: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

May in Cappadocia averages 9°C–22°C with 40 mm of rainfall. Crowd levels are high, hot air balloon flights operate at 85–95%, and hotel prices are high.

Cappadocia Weather in June: Temperature, Rainfall & What to Expect

June in Cappadocia averages 12°C–27°C with 25 mm of rainfall. Crowd levels are high, hot air balloon flights operate at 90–95%, and hotel prices are high.
